South Extension Market: Delhi’s South Extension Market is famous for its big showrooms and boutiques. But you know, a very beautiful and historical place is hidden behind this dazzle? Yes, the tomb of the elder Khan and Chhoti Khan made in Kotla Mubarakpur of South Extension. These mausoleums built in the 16th century are the best sample of Mughal art.
Here are two mausoleums
The domes here are famous for their height and carving. On the walls, you will get to see Islamic design and flower figures made of stones. The tomb of the big mine is slightly larger in size, while the tomb of the small mine is slightly smaller. There are tombs inside both mausters.
Greenery all around
There is an open courtyard around the mausoleums, where the paths of stones and small gardens are built. Here you will experience greenery and peace. If you are a history lover or just want to spend a moment of relaxation for some time, then come here with your family and friends.
Opening time
These mausoleums are open from 7:00 am to 7:00 pm. To reach here, you can land South Extension Metro Station. The mausoleums are located just 300 meters from the metro station.
